In some cases, the mismatch can be tiny. For example, whenever a β-BBO crystal is utilized to frequency double 1550 nm mild and provide 775 nm light-weight, the team velocity mismatch is only some femtoseconds for each millimeter.

The difficulty that arises when applying ultrashort pulses for second harmonic technology (SHG) is the fact shorter pulses have greater bandwidths, but The best phase-matched affliction can be attained For less than a single basic wavelength at any given time. As a consequence of this, the caliber of the section match is usually noticeably even worse to the spectral edges of broad-bandwidth pulses.

Many components can affect the efficiency of BBO crystals. These involve temperature, humidity, and the standard of the incident gentle. Good handling and storage can help keep the crystal’s general performance. Temperature can impact the period-matching ailments of BBO crystals, which in turn has an effect on their performance in frequency conversion applications.

Too much optical intensities in the course of Procedure could immediately problems a crystal. Regretably, nonlinear crystals typically should be operated not considerably from their optical damage threshold to realize a sufficiently substantial conversion efficiency. This implies a trade-off involving conversion performance and crystal lifetime.
